Outcomes of patients with hepaticojejunostomy anastomotic strictures undergoing endoscopic and percutaneous treatment
Conclusions DBE-ERCP is an effective diagnostic and therapeutic tool in those with altered gastrointestinal anatomy and is associated with low complication rates.
